Virtual Therapy: A Accessible Solution for Mental Health
In today's fast-paced world, seeking mental health support can sometimes feel daunting. Traditional therapy often involves scheduling appointments, commuting to sessions, and fitting time into a busy routine. Fortunately, online therapy has emerged as a effective alternative, offering a flexible solution for individuals needing mental health care. With online therapy, you can connect with licensed therapists from the comfort of your own home, at times that suit your schedule. This eliminates geographical limitations and allows for greater anonymity, making it an attractive option for many people.
A key advantage of online therapy is its flexibility. Sessions can be conducted via video call, phone, or even instant messaging, allowing you to engage with a therapist at your own pace and in a setting that feels comfortable. This can minimize the anxiety often associated with in-person therapy appointments.
- Furthermore, online therapy platforms often offer a wider range of therapists focusing in different areas of mental health, increasing your chances of finding the right fit for your needs.
- The cost of online therapy can also be competitive compared to traditional therapy, making it a affordable option for many individuals.
Connecting with a Therapist: Online vs. In-Person
Deciding that to connect with a therapist online or in person is a unique choice. Neither methods offer valuable strengths. Online therapy provides ease, allowing you to access appointments from the safety of your own home. In-person therapy, on the other part, can offer a more direct connection and opportunity for nonverbal interaction.
- When choosing among online and in-person therapy, take into account your needs.
- Think about your preference with technology and remote interactions.
- Evaluate the relevance of face-to-face connection.
Ultimately, the best approach is the one that feels most suitable for you.
